System Information
Name of facility is - WRB Refining Wood River Refinery in Roxana; formerly Shell Oil Refinery (Shell "Wood River" Mfg Complex) and formerly Tosco.
Seems as there may also be a conventional repeater on 858.4125 CSQ. Voice Operations are in use, with no MOT TG showing at times. May have been talk about "go up" (as in a crane.) Also, 858.4125 is VERY ACTIVE during the day on the TRS TGs. I-CALLs are very active on this system.
At this time control channel appears to change at midnight or 1 am (DST) and currently has 3 control channels. (3/20/10)
